What is Ohm Law ?

1 Answer

Answer :

ohm law : current flowing through a conductor at constant temperature সম proportional to the voltage difference between the two ends of the conductor and disproportionate to the resistance " Explanation " , But according to Ohm's formula I = V / R i.e. V = IR
